Description


A fresh historical perspective on the fifty years since the founding of the Black Panther Party, in which the world's largest police state has emerged.

About the Author


Donna Murch is an Associate Professor of History at Rutgers, the State University of New Jersey, and sits on the Executive Council of the Rutgers AAUP-AFT.She is the author of Living for the City: Migration, Education, and the Rise of the Black Panther Party in Oakland, California (University of North Carolina Press).
